Abstract
The recent history of Latin America is marked by the implementation and longevity of the neoliberal capitalist economic model, by the resistance of the working classes to this model and by the attempts of some governments in the region to reform or even overcome it. This history is also marked by the struggle of working women, popular movements of black, indigenous and LGBT people and also by new forms of domination and imperialist intervention in the subcontinent.
